Output 075660789b6365ebad2b167621bd84e1d316d611595a16aa5551d4d30ad8baa4:27

value
1077000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be1ed7ec708ef7a1d82988003cb4cd799296be3b OP_EQUAL
address
3K2HG2pHtjy7JMroe2iqa47m25A1jA3eGx
transaction
075660789b6365ebad2b167621bd84e1d316d611595a16aa5551d4d30ad8baa4
spent
true